  • Rated 3 out of 5 stars

    Just a Versa 2 with a bad button redesign

    |
    |
    Posted . Owned for 3 weeks when reviewed.
    This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.

    I have a Versa 2. The only thing I didn’t care for on the Versa 2 was the band attachment design which was derivative of the old Blaze. That is the only significant improvement on the Sense/Versa 3 where the design is MUCH better then previous Fitbit solutions. No more fumbling with pins. I like exchanging the band out on a nearly daily basis so this is a welcome improvement. Now they just need to start making bands. However there are too many issues to justify the upgrade. 1. UI is sluggish. Screen response time can be slow to point where you are guessing whether or not you actually swiped the screen or pushed the button. 2. The button or lack thereof is a PAIN. It refuses to recognize my thumb when depressing. I have to contort my index finger to get it to work and then press VERY firmly. . THEN at random times the button will register against my arm if I flex my wrist just so! The actual physical button on the Versa 2 was much better! 3. The ECG is a manual process. The watch does not monitor in the background. I don’t understand the usefulness of this feature if you have to manually test all the time. It should be automatically checking In background at periodic intervals ( once an hour? ) 4. The SPO2 only works if you use the ( ugly) clock face supplied by Fitbit! Forget installing other clock faces through the store if you want to monitor SPO2! 5. Nebulous metrics. There are a host of metrics with absolutely no insight into the meaning relative to your overall health. For example, Heartrate variability. No documentation offered to explain the usefulness of this metric and how this could be symptomatic. Overall , I’m a bit disappointed especially when compared to the Versa 2.

  • Rated 1 out of 5 stars

    Fitbit Sense

    |
    |
    Posted . Owned for 4 months when reviewed.
    This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.

    This is my third Fitbit Sense the latest purchased new in January 2023. Now it’s May 8, 2023 and the unit is not properly recording my Heart Rate during sleep which ties into sleep activity recording. It was recording my sleep activity correctly until May 1, 2023. Now it shows this message on Sleep Details “Your tracker couldn’t get a consistent heart-rate reading while you slept” Nothing changed after May 1, 2023 so I am not sure why this is now happening. This unit as with previous ones has also stopped recording breathing rate and heart rate variability. I use the Fitbit to record my swim laps and that is when the issues seem to start. If the Fitbit does not detect a consistent HR it will not record your sleep correctly. Same issue as my previous purchases. Fitbit Support is of no help and I already have their troubleshooting steps memorized from calling in on the past two units which eventually crashed. I bought the third unit because I was told those issues were fixed in a FW Update and the units was on sale. Looks like the Garmin will be my next choice.
